Srinagar: Indoor Taekwondo Academy delivered an impressive performance at the Chenab Open Taekwondo Championship, securing the 2nd runner-up trophy after winning 17 medals, including eight gold, four silver and five bronze.
According to details available with the news agency Kashmir News Observer (KNO), gold medals were won by Suvaid Ahmad, Abbas Khursheed, Aleena Nisar, Hafida Rafiq, Ajiya Nasir, Aayat Jan, Mehreen Jan, Serrat Ayub and coach Zain Nazir.
Silver medals were secured by Zaheeb Javaid Malik, Essa Bin Sajid, Aiman Bashir and Suvaid Ahmad, while Mohammed Musineen, Mohammed Eesa Bhat, Aftab Malik, Zunaira Fatimah and Aleena Nisar claimed bronze medals in their respective events.
In the Poomsae category, Suvaid Ahmad and Aiman Bashir won silver medals, while Aleena Nisar secured bronze.
The academy team was led by international Taekwondo player and coach Zain Nazir, who trains athletes at the Taekwondo Centre, Gindun Stadium, Rajbagh. Competing under his guidance, the academy finished as the second runner-up in the championship.
